Testudo burgenlandica
Taxonomy
Testudo burgenlandica was named by Bachmayer and Mlynarski (1983). Its type specimen is NHMW 1981/0024/0001, a partial shell, and it is a 3D body fossil. Its type locality is Kohfidisch, which is in a MN 11 terrestrial horizon in Austria.
